'Tish, You Spoke French

Those are famous words spoken by Gomez Addams to Morticia Addams from the short run television series, The Addams Family. Whenever Morticia spoke French, no matter where he was, or what he was doing, Gomez would race to her and declare, "'Tish, you spoke French!" Then he would begin kissing up her arm, beginning at the wrist and ending at the back of her neck. Most of the time Morticia would interrupt him with some practical reason, "Gomez, Uncle Fester now, savoir faire later."

It came to mind just now because of my cat. Firestar (his name is Firestar, in case you failed to pick up on that) was upstairs sleeping on the bed. I initiated a print job from my computer. Firestar loves to watch the printer in action. Two seconds after the printer gave its noisy signal that printing was soon to ensue, Firestar came crashing down the stairs like Gomez Addams racing to Morticia. I chuckle every time he does this. I've seen people do that with telephones, too. Well, before most people began carrying telephones in their pocket.
